Mark Walter Considers Selling His Stake in Chelsea FC to Clearlake Capital
19 Ağustos 2026Bloomberg
- Mark Walter, the billionaire CEO of Guggenheim, is considering selling his stake in Chelsea FC to Clearlake Capital, the club's majority owner. This potential sale follows Walter's recent record-breaking transaction involving the Los Angeles Lakers, which was sold for $12.5 billion.
- The move highlights Walter's strategic focus on maximizing his investments in the sports industry.
- The sports industry has seen a surge in investment activity, particularly in football clubs, as wealthy individuals and firms seek to capitalize on the growing global popularity of the sport.
